Here is what "might" work. Drain the tank. Clean the seam from one end to the other. Do not use alcohol or vinegar. Water and a lot of scrubbing. Use a syringe bottle with the thin needle and try to fill the seam leak area with some solvent (weld-on #4 will work). Get a piece of square acrylic rod 2x thicker than the tank acrylic and weld it to the seam (weld-on # 4 will work). If you don't have experience with acrylic, have a professional do it.
